.footer-widget-1{margin-top:4em !important}
@media only screen and (max-width: 500px){.person{width:100% !important}}

.fa{font-style:normal;font-variant:normal;font-weight:normal;font-family:FontAwesome;}

#main .taxonomy-description{display:none !important}
.wp-block-columns {
    text-align: center !important;
}
.wp-block-buttons{
    display: block !important;
    text-align: center;
    margin: 0 auto;
    float: none;
}
.wp-block-button__link {
    border: 2px solid green !important;
    border-radius: 30px !important;
    color: green !important;
}
#block-8{margin-left:4.5em !important}
.page-header .page-title{display:none}
@media only screen and (max-width: 500px){ 
.one{
width: 100% !important;

}
.right img{height:auto !important}
.below img{height:auto !important}
	.two{
		width:100% !important;
	}
		.three{
		width:100% !important;
	}
	.card{
width: 100% !important;
}
	.img{ 
	height:200px !important;
	}

}

@media only screen and (max-width: 768px){ 

	.tab{
		width:100% !important;}

	.card{
width: 100% !important;
}

}

@media only screen and (max-width: 480px){
  ul.products li.product{width:100% !important; float:left; height: auto !important;}
}

@media only screen and (max-width: 768px){ 
.bottomLine{display:block !important;width:60% !important; margin:auto !important}
}

.onsale{
bottom: 99% !important;}
.posted_in a:first-child{display:none}


@media only screen and (max-width: 680px){
.mobch {
 margin-top: 6em !important;}}

.yith-wcbm-badge.yith-wcbm-badge-image.yith-wcbm-badge-2812027 {
    left: 160px !important;}
@media only screen and (max-width: 680px){
.yith-wcbm-badge.yith-wcbm-badge-image.yith-wcbm-badge-2812027 {
    left: 220px !important;}}